

Patricia Rose Hartman, 69, of Springfield, died at 7:02 a.m. on Monday, January 27, 2014 at St. John's Hospital. Patricia was born July 23, 1944 in Springfield, the daughter of Edward and Josephine Clifford Norris. She married Richard Hartman on October 2, 1965; they later divorced. Patricia was a graduate of Ursuline Academy and then went to Michael Reese Hospital in Chicago for nursing school. She was a member of Church of the Little Flower and ran a daycare. Patricia enjoyed reading, crocheting and spending time with her family. She was preceded in death by her parents; three brothers, Jim, John and Kenneth Norris; and five sisters, Margaret Treat, Bernadine Norris, Mary Jo Knudson, Marilyn Brown and Dorothy Cox. She is survived by five sons, Ahren (Terri) of Chicago, Michael (Kris) of Atlanta, Paul (Chris) of Cedar Rapids, IA, Stephen (Elizabeth) of Springfield, and Matthew (Heather) Hartman of Auburn; eight grandchildren; one sister, Kathleen VanLeer of Springfield; and several nieces, nephews and cousins.
